This Study Aims to Compare Asthma Control in Children Monitored With FeNO Against a Historical Cohort Without FeNO. Secondary Objectives Include Evaluating Associations Between FeNO Levels, ACT/C-ACT Scores, Eosinophil Counts, FEV1%, ICS Adherence, and Exacerbation Frequency.

Summary
This study aims to evaluate whether incorporating FeNO monitoring into routine pediatric asthma care improves clinical outcomes relative to a historical cohort managed without FeNO

Interventions
- DIAGNOSTIC_TEST
-
FENO
Registration: Eligible participants will be registered consecutively during clinic visits after obtaining informed consent (and assent where applicable). * Randomization: As this is an observational study comparing prospective data with historical controls, no randomization will be performed. 2.4 Data Gathering Methods * Prospective FeNO Group: Monthly data collection over 3 months including ACT/ C-ACT questionnaires, FeNO measurements using portable point-of-care devices, spirometry (FEV1%), and peripheral blood eosinophil counts. * Historical Control Group: Extraction of relevant clinical data (ACT/C-ACT scores, spirometry, eosinophil counts, ICS adherence, and exacerbation records) from electronic medical records covering a comparable 3-month timeframe. 2.5 Procedures and Central Laboratories * FeNO measurements will be conducted using a validated, portable FeNO device standardized across study sites. * Spirometry will be performed according to American Thoracic Society guidelines
